WebThe two last steps in this pathway are catalyzed by a single enzyme, tryptophan synthase, which is composed of two α and two β subunits (E.C. reaction 4.2.1.20). However, it has been shown that each of the subunits is responsible for catalyzing an individual step, and is able to catalyze that step on its own. WebIndoleamine 2.3-dioxygenase (IDO) is a heme-containing monomeric enzyme that catalyzes the conversion of tryptophan (TRP) into kynurenine (KYN) and is the rate-limiting enzyme in the TRP-KYN pathway. IDO has immunomodulatory effects due to its important role in tryptophan metabolism.
